      Ukrainian Research Institute of Agricultural Radiology is a structural subdivision of the National University of Life and Environmental Sciences of Ukraine. The scientists of the Institute solve the issues of agricultural production in the contaminated areas, which is a major problem in agricultural radiology in Ukraine.

     In spring 2014, the scientists of the institute started an experiment at the territory of Drevlyanskyy Nature Reserve in Narodytskyy district of Zhytomyr region. The experiment is a part of the scientific programme “Study of changes of physical and chemical status, mobility and bioavailability of radionuclides 90Sr and 137Cs under the influence of soil microflora” (scientific supervisor — Doctor of Biological Sciences, Professor I.M. Gudkov). The aim of the experiment is to obtain data on accumulation of 137Cs and 90Sr by rape, wheat and millet provided pre-treatment of seeds with bacterial preparations containing microorganisms that according to preliminary data hinder their transition from soil.

     The experiment has three repetitions, thirteen options and control stage. Sampling was conducted in three phases. Prepared samples were analysed in the laboratory of the Research Institute of Agricultural Radiology.

     As a result, the data on the power of gamma background in the experimental area was obtained and analysed and agrochemical soil analysis was conducted. Currently an active phase of measurements of the specific activity of soil and green mass of plants takes place.
